«error-handling» 태그된 질문

오류 코드, 예외 또는 기타 언어 별 수단에 의해 신호가 표시되는 오류를 처리하도록 설계된 프로그래밍 언어 구성.

5
htaccess를 통해서만 PHP에서 오류 표시 활성화
온라인으로 웹 사이트를 테스트하고 있습니다. 지금은 오류가 표시되지 않습니다 (하지만 오류가 있음을 알고 있습니다). .htaccess파일 에만 액세스 할 수 있습니다. 내 .htaccess파일을 사용하여 모든 오류를 표시하려면 어떻게합니까 ? 내 .htaccess파일 에 다음 줄을 추가했습니다 . php_flag display_startup_errors on php_flag display_errors on php_flag html_errors on 이제 페이지 가 표시됩니다. 인터넷 서버 …

6
자바 스크립트에서 특정 오류 처리 (예외를 생각해보세요)
다른 유형의 오류를 어떻게 구현하여 특정 오류를 포착하고 다른 오류가 발생하도록 할 수 있습니다 ..? 이를 달성하는 한 가지 방법은 Error객체 의 프로토 타입을 수정하는 것입니다 . Error.prototype.sender = ""; function throwSpecificError() { var e = new Error(); e.sender = "specific"; throw e; } 특정 오류 포착 : try { …

5
단일 값 컨텍스트의 여러 값
Go의 오류 처리로 인해 종종 여러 값 함수로 끝납니다. 지금까지 내가 이것을 관리하는 방법은 매우 지저분했고 더 깨끗한 코드를 작성하는 모범 사례를 찾고 있습니다. 다음과 같은 기능이 있다고 가정 해 보겠습니다. type Item struct { Value int Name string } func Get(value int) (Item, error) { // some code return …

6
ASP.NET MVC에서 오류 로깅
현재 ASP.NET MVC 응용 프로그램에서 log4net을 사용하여 예외를 기록하고 있습니다. 이 작업을 수행하는 방법은 모든 컨트롤러가 BaseController 클래스에서 상속되도록하는 것입니다. BaseController의 OnActionExecuting 이벤트에서 발생한 모든 예외를 기록합니다. protected override void OnActionExecuted(ActionExecutedContext filterContext) { // Log any exceptions ILog log = LogManager.GetLogger(filterContext.Controller.GetType()); if (filterContext.Exception != null) { log.Error("Unhandled exception: " + …

10
ASP.NET MVC 사용자 지정 오류 처리 Application_Error Global.asax?
내 MVC 응용 프로그램의 오류를 확인하는 몇 가지 기본 코드가 있습니다. 현재 내 프로젝트에서 나는라는 컨트롤러가 Error동작 방법과를 HTTPError404(), HTTPError500()하고 General(). 모두 문자열 매개 변수를 error받습니다. 아래 코드를 사용하거나 수정합니다. 처리를 위해 데이터를 오류 컨트롤러에 전달하는 가장 좋은 / 올바른 방법은 무엇입니까? 가능한 한 강력한 솔루션을 갖고 싶습니다. protected void …


8
0으로 나누고 0을 반환하는 방법
파이썬에서 요소 현명한 나누기를 수행하려고하지만 0이 발생하면 몫이 0이되어야합니다. 예를 들면 : array1 = np.array([0, 1, 2]) array2 = np.array([0, 1, 1]) array1 / array2 # should be np.array([0, 1, 2]) 항상 내 데이터를 통해 for 루프를 사용할 수 있지만 실제로 numpy의 최적화를 활용하려면 오류를 무시하는 대신 0으로 나누기 오류를 …

11
LNK2019 오류를 해결하는 방법 : 해결되지 않은 외부 기호-기능?
이 오류가 발생하지만 해결 방법을 모르겠습니다. 저는 Visual Studio 2013을 사용하고 있습니다. 솔루션 이름을 MyProjectTest로 지정했습니다. 이것은 테스트 솔루션의 구조입니다. - function.h #ifndef MY_FUNCTION_H #define MY_FUNCTION_H int multiple(int x, int y); #endif -function.cpp #include "function.h" int multiple(int x, int y){ return x*y; } - MAIN.CPP #include <iostream> #include <cstdlib> #include …


4
쉘 파이프에서 오류 코드 포착
현재 다음과 같은 스크립트가 있습니다. ./a | ./b | ./c a, b 또는 c 중 하나가 오류 코드와 함께 종료되면 오류 메시지를 인쇄하고 잘못된 출력을 앞으로 파이프하는 대신 중지하도록 수정하고 싶습니다. 그렇게하는 가장 간단하고 깨끗한 방법은 무엇입니까?

8
서버에서 클라이언트 측 JavaScript 오류 로깅 [닫힘]
닫힘 . 이 질문은 더 집중되어야 합니다. 현재 답변을 받고 있지 않습니다. 이 질문을 개선하고 싶으십니까? 이 게시물 을 편집 하여 한 가지 문제에만 집중하도록 질문을 업데이트하십시오 . 휴일 육년 전 . 이 질문 개선 수동 테스트만으로 JavaScript 오류를 찾는 데 문제가있는 ASP.NET 사이트를 운영하고 있습니다. 클라이언트 측에서 모든 JavaScript …

1
자바 스크립트에서 'throw'후에 'return'을해야하나요?
나는 Error아래와 같이 조기 종료를 원하는 내 방법에서 던지고 있습니다. // No route found if(null === nextRoute) { throw new Error('BAD_ROUTE'); } return;내 뒤에 진술서 를 넣어야 throw합니까? 지금은 저에게 효과적입니다. 불필요한 경우에는 넣지 않고 다른 브라우저가 무엇을 할 수 있는지 확신 할 수 없습니다.

3
방금 호출 한 오류의 줄 번호를 인쇄하는 Golang 프로그램을 어떻게 얻습니까?
내 Golang 프로그램에서 오류를 던지려고 log.Fatal했지만 실행 된 log.Fatal줄도 인쇄하지 않습니다 log.Fatal. log.Fatal을 호출 한 줄 번호에 액세스 할 수있는 방법이 없습니까? 즉, 오류를 던질 때 줄 번호를 얻는 방법이 있습니까? 나는 이것을 구글로 시도했지만 방법을 확신하지 못했습니다. 내가 얻을 수있는 가장 좋은 방법 은 스택 트레이스를 인쇄하는 것이 었는데 …

5
PHP 5.4에서 엄격한 표준 비활성화
나는 현재 php 5.4에서 사이트를 운영하고 있는데, 그 전에는 5.3.8에서 내 사이트를 운영하고있었습니다. 불행하게도, PHP 5.4을 결합 E_ALL하고 E_STRICT, 수단 내 이전 설정은 error_reporting이제 작동하지 않습니다. 내 이전 값은 E_ALL & ~E_NOTICE & ~E_STRICT한 번에 하나씩 값을 활성화해야합니까? 오류가 너무 많고 파일에 수정하기에 너무 많은 코드가 포함되어 있습니다.

15
C에서 오류 관리를위한 goto의 유효한 사용?
이 질문은 사실 얼마 전 programming.reddit.com에서 흥미로운 토론 의 결과입니다 . 기본적으로 다음 코드로 요약됩니다. int foo(int bar) { int return_value = 0; if (!do_something( bar )) { goto error_1; } if (!init_stuff( bar )) { goto error_2; } if (!prepare_stuff( bar )) { goto error_3; } return_value = do_the_thing( …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.